Customer did purchase a television from us and we did install it for him. After six months, we received a call from *** *** that the television was leaning. Within minutes of this phone call we arrived at their home to find that the television had since fallen to the
ground and was damaged beyond repairThe customer made no attempt to try to save the television even though it had not fallen yet. After investigating the damage, we determined that everything had been installed and mounted correctly as the main television bracket was still firmly attached to the wall correctly. the screws that held the bracket arms of the wall mount to the TV somehow came loose and caused the TV to fall off of the main bracketWe had never seen this type of incident before and since this happened six months after the original installation, we told the homeowner that it would be best to contact his homeowners insurance to address the situation as the TV had been mounted correctly and it seemed to be some other reason that it fell off the bracketThe ***'s insisted that I contact my insurance company to deal with this problem, which I did. Our insurance company said that it was not covered under our policy, however the damage to their hardwood floors would be covered (not sure why, but that's what they told me)This obviously did not sit well with the customer. In the agreement/contract that *** signed when making the original television purchase from us states under the section "Liability": that "In no event shall SAS be liable for any incident, special, incidental or consequential damages resulting from SAS's performance of services under this agreement or from the furnishing, performance or use of any products sold under this agreement or any other agreement". To me, this means that we are not liable for the damages and that the customer agreed to this when they signed our contract.In lieu of this section of the signed agreement, we have decided to resolve this issue with the ***'s and we are replacing the customers 75" television and providing them with a new mounting bracket to replace the originally installed mount. Although we still do not feel that we should be held responsible for this issue (specifically because of the signed contract/agreement), we do feel for our customers and decided that taking care of this was the right thing to doThis complaint has been resolved as far as we are concerned
